Abstract

The growth of wind farms in Brazil brings new challenges to the Brazilian electrical system, such as the adequacy of regulation for system operation, the supply-demand balance, the quality of the supplied power, and the system stability. New technologies associated with smart grids will enable an increase in intermittent renewable sources connected to the power distribution system. D-STATCOM (Distribution Static Synchronous Compensator) provides the necessary resources to prevent technical problems in systems with high penetration of wind power plants. It makes possible the wind farms to meet the requirements of network connection as power factor, voltage output and fault ride through requirements, as well as increases the transmission capacity and the network stability. This paper presents the dynamic behavior obtained by computer simulation of a distribution grid at 34.5 kV with D-STATCOM and wind farms. The use of D-STATCOM contributed to increasing the stability margin of the system, allowing the permanence of the three wind farms during fault and post-fault conditions.
